Senior Speech and Language Therapist
Location: Thatcham, Berkshire
Contract: Permanent
Hours: Full-time (37.5 hrs/wk, 52 wks/yr) – Part-time from 14 hrs/wk considered
Specialty: Special Educational Needs
Salary: £36,000 – £53,000 (dependant on qualifications and experience)
Mind Professionals are now recruiting for a permanent Senior Speech and Language Therapist role based at a Special Educational Needs school in Thatcham, Berkshire.
The post holder will be managing a caseload of autistic young people with complex needs, including assessment, implementation and review of therapy input to ensure progress.
In addition to this, the post holder will lead development and implementation of Speech and Language Therapy practices.
Key Responsibilities:
– To lead development and implementation of Speech and Language Therapy practices at Prior’s Court.
– Manage a caseload of autistic YP with complex needs, including assessment, implementation and review of therapy input to ensure progress.
– To line manage the team of Speech and Language Therapists.
– Contribute and/or lead in the planning and delivering of training to develop the knowledge and skills of others in the areas of autism and communication.
– To deliver input through use of the Prior’s Court Communication Skills Learning Programme, which will prepare all YP to have a functional communication system to enable them to live healthy, happy, independent lives after leaving Prior’s Court.
– Provide specialist intervention using evidence-based therapy approaches individualised to meet YP’s needs in the areas of (not an exhaustive list) expression, understanding, social communication and AAC (low and high tech.).
– Contribution to the annual review process by providing high quality written reports, assessment, review of EHCP targets and attending annual review meetings (as appropriate).
